Lot.parser: 实现中文句子及其翻译的批号解析
需积分: 9 165 浏览量
更新于2024-11-10
收藏 6KB ZIP 举报
资源摘要信息:"Lot.parser:批次分析器是一个用于处理表格或类似表格数据的JavaScript脚本工具。其主要用途在于将一系列成对数据(如多种语言的翻译句子对)进行格式化处理,并转换为JSON对象格式。在开发和数据处理过程中,经常需要对数据进行清晰地分类和标识,而Lot.parser通过定义一个批次解析器,使得开发者能够高效地管理语言对(如中文和英语对)数据,并以结构化的形式展示。
Lot.parser的核心是其解析逻辑,其基本工作流程如下:
1. 输入数据的组织:需要处理的数据以一种类似于表格的形式排列,每对数据占据一行,分列显示。例如,一行中左侧为中文句子,右侧为对应的英文翻译。
2. 数据解析:Lot.parser读取这样的表格数据,并识别每一对数据,将其从原始格式转换为JSON格式的数据结构。
3. JSON输出:解析后,数据被组织成一个名为`mainDataSet`的JSON数组,每个数组元素也是一个对象,包含`cmn`和`eng`两个属性,分别代表中文和英语内容。
使用Lot.parser可以带来以下几点好处:
- 数据结构化:将无结构的文本数据转换为结构化的JSON数据,方便进行进一步的数据处理和交换。
- 简化开发流程:避免了繁琐的手动编写代码,减少出错的可能性,提高了开发效率。
- 提高可读性:JSON格式比原始文本格式更易于阅读和理解,有助于团队协作和代码维护。
- 可扩展性:通过编写脚本处理数据,可以轻松应对数据量的增加,对大型项目尤其有益。
Lot.parser的标签为"JavaScript",表明这个批次分析器可能是用JavaScript语言编写的。JavaScript是一种广泛应用于网页开发的脚本语言,它在服务器端(Node.js)、桌面应用(使用Electron等框架)以及命令行脚本中都有应用。由于其跨平台的特性,JavaScript为Lot.parser提供了一个良好的开发基础。
根据【压缩包子文件的文件名称列表】中提供的信息,我们可以推断出Lot.parser可能是一个开源项目,且源代码托管在某个版本控制系统上,例如GitHub。从名称Lot.parser-master可以推测,该仓库的名称为Lot.parser,且当前检出的分支是master,通常代表稳定版本或者项目的主分支。通过访问该仓库,开发者可以查看和下载源代码,甚至参与项目的贡献和改进。
在实际使用Lot.parser时,开发者可能需要具备一定的JavaScript编程知识,以及对JSON数据格式的理解。此外,熟练使用文本编辑器或者集成开发环境(IDE)进行编程,以及掌握版本控制系统的使用也是必要的。如果Lot.parser支持命令行操作,那么还需要对命令行工具有所了解。
综上所述,Lot.parser:批次分析器是开发者处理数据对和生成JSON格式数据的有力工具,通过它可提高数据处理的效率和准确性,同时也体现了JavaScript在数据处理方面的强大功能和灵活性。"
268 浏览量
2021-02-04 上传
2021-04-10 上传
2023-07-17 上传
2023-07-17 上传
2023-06-10 上传
2021-04-03 上传
2021-02-04 上传
谁家扁舟子
- 粉丝: 30
- 资源: 4678
最新资源
- Raspberry Pi OpenCL驱动程序安装与QEMU仿真指南
- Apache RocketMQ Go客户端:全面支持与消息处理功能
- WStage平台:无线传感器网络阶段数据交互技术
- 基于Java SpringBoot和微信小程序的ssm智能仓储系统开发
- CorrectMe项目:自动更正与建议API的开发与应用
- IdeaBiz请求处理程序JAVA:自动化API调用与令牌管理
- 墨西哥面包店研讨会:介绍关键业绩指标(KPI)与评估标准
- 2014年Android音乐播放器源码学习分享
- CleverRecyclerView扩展库:滑动效果与特性增强
- 利用Python和SURF特征识别斑点猫图像
- Wurpr开源PHP MySQL包装器:安全易用且高效
- Scratch少儿编程:Kanon妹系闹钟音效素材包
- 食品分享社交应用的开发教程与功能介绍
- Cookies by lfj.io: 浏览数据智能管理与同步工具
- 掌握SSH框架与SpringMVC Hibernate集成教程
- C语言实现FFT算法及互相关性能优化指南